## Environments — Quillweave Render Service

Quillweave runs three environments: dev, staging, and prod. Template rendering latency differs sharply between them because staging shares a cache tier with the Bramblehook batch jobs, so benchmark results from staging should be treated cautiously. Before reviewing the partial-caching change, confirm the environment settings below match your test target.

config for tawif-bagef:
[sorwyn]
team = sorys
access_code = ac_9ba40c
host = sorwyn.ordingrid.local
port = 5000
owner = aldok.quenion
peer = belath.paliqcloud.local

## Configuration

Graphlume reads its settings from a `.env` file in the project root. Support staff should confirm that `GRAPHLUME_LAYOUT` is set to either `radial` or `tiered`, and that `GRAPHLUME_MAX_NODES` does not exceed 5000 on shared instances, as larger dependency graphs will exhaust the render worker. Cache paths default to `/var/cache/graphlume` and must be writable. Once those values are verified, add the registry access token on the line immediately following this sentence.

secret setting of fawep-tagaf: ARCHIVE_KEY3=ce5

## Step 5: Mitigate the planner regression

Version 9.2 of Quillbase reintroduced nested-loop plans on wide joins. Plugins issuing analytical queries will see timeouts until the planner hints land in 9.3. As a stopgap, force the legacy cost model per connection. Set the following configuration values in your plugin's session bootstrap:

config for bahop-fajep:
DRUATH_PIN=4501
DRUATH_TENANT=briwyn
DRUATH_METRICS_HOST=metrics.druath.brasksoft.test
DRUATH_SEAL=seal_7d2e069d
DRUATH_STANDBY_TEAM=olieth